The Early Years of Charles Barkley

Charles Barkley, also known as Sir Charles, was born in Alabama in 1963. He played college basketball for Auburn University, where he made a name for himself as an athletic power forward. Barkley turned pro in 1984, joining the Philadelphia 76ers as the fifth overall pick in the NBA draft.

Barkley quickly made an impact in his first few seasons with the 76ers, averaging double figures in points and rebounds. He would go on to lead the team in scoring and rebounding for five consecutive seasons, earning his first All-Star nod in 1987.

Barkley's Move to Phoenix

In 1992, Barkley was traded to the Phoenix Suns, where he would spend the majority of his career. The move proved to be a great decision for both Barkley and the Suns, as he would go on to have some of his best seasons in Phoenix.

In his first year with the Suns, Barkley was named the league's Most Valuable Player, thanks to his impressive stat line of 25.6 points, 12.2 rebounds, and 5.1 assists per game.

  • Who is Michael Jordan?

    Michael Jordan is a retired professional basketball player who played for the Chicago Bulls and Washington Wizards. He is widely regarded as the greatest basketball player of all time.

  • What makes Michael Jordan the best player in NBA history?

    Michael Jordan's statistics and accomplishments speak for themselves. He won six NBA championships, five MVP awards, and ten scoring titles. He was also selected to the All-Star team 14 times and was named the NBA Finals MVP six times. His competitive fire, incredible athleticism, and clutch performances make him stand out as the best player ever.

  • What was Michael Jordan's greatest game?

    There are many games that could be considered Michael Jordan's greatest, but perhaps his most memorable performance was in Game 5 of the 1997 NBA Finals against the Utah Jazz. Jordan had been suffering from flu-like symptoms and was visibly weak and sick throughout the game, yet he still managed to score 38 points and lead the Bulls to victory.

  • How did Michael Jordan change the NBA?

    Michael Jordan's impact on the NBA goes beyond his individual statistics and accomplishments. He helped popularize the sport around the world, making it a global phenomenon. He also set a new standard for excellence and competitiveness, inspiring future generations of players to strive for greatness.
